2018 PLN to TZS Performance & Market Timing Review
Analysis of key historical highlights and timing insights for 2018
During 2018, the PLN to TZS exchange rate experienced significant fluctuation. The market reached its absolute peak on February 15, valuing the pair at 678.5519. Conversely, the yearly low was recorded on October 31, dropping to 596.7690.
This high-to-low spread represents a total annual volatility of 81.7829 TZS. From a start-to-finish perspective, comparing the January average rate of 658.9279 to the December average rate of 610.5839, the exchange rate registered a net change of -7.34% (reflecting a weakening trend).
Looking at year-over-year peak valuations, the 2018 high of 678.5519 was up 0.01% compared to the 2017 peak of 678.4645, indicating shifts in long-term support levels.

Monthly Breakdown
Statistical summary for each calendar month.
| Month | High | Low | Average |
|---|---|---|---|
| January | 677.2812 | 638.8889 | 658.9279 |
| February | 678.5519 | 657.4949 | 667.5784 |
| March | 667.7426 | 655.1877 | 661.1443 |
| April | 677.3720 | 651.1182 | 665.4486 |
| May | 642.6230 | 607.2681 | 629.3835 |
| June | 630.3151 | 602.9586 | 618.0498 |
| July | 624.7481 | 602.2078 | 615.8926 |
| August | 625.0978 | 598.6757 | 614.7941 |
| September | 627.6161 | 611.6631 | 618.7917 |
| October | 618.4028 | 596.7690 | 610.5226 |
| November | 612.1375 | 597.0473 | 607.0146 |
| December | 615.0646 | 607.1052 | 610.5839 |
